Processing Power

The Athlon 64 FX-72 packs 2 cores / 2 threads, while the Phenom II X3 B75 offers 3 cores / 3 threads — the Phenom II X3 B75 has 1 more core. Boost clocks reach 2.8 GHz on the Athlon 64 FX-72 versus 3 GHz on the Phenom II X3 B75 — a 6.9% clock advantage for the Phenom II X3 B75. The Athlon 64 FX-72 uses the Windsor (2006−2007) architecture (90 nm), while the Phenom II X3 B75 uses Heka (2009−2010) (45 nm). In PassMark, the Athlon 64 FX-72 scores 1,794 against the Phenom II X3 B75's 1,783 — a 0.6% lead for the Athlon 64 FX-72. L3 cache: 0 kB on the Athlon 64 FX-72 vs 6 MB (total) on the Phenom II X3 B75.
